Optimization and Assessment of the Comprehensive Performance of an Axial Separator by Response Surface Methodology
2023
Journal of Applied Fluid Mechanics
The separator with inner channels is designed to solve the inefficiency caused by particle collisions with the wall. Then the response surface methodology is used to optimize this novel separator with the aim of maximizing the separation efficiency and exhaust rate while minimizing the pressure drop simultaneously.
